+5V microprocessor supervisory circuit. Reset threshold 4.65V, active-low reset, backup-battery switchover, power-fail comparator, watchdog input, battery freshness seal.

### **Descriptions:**  
- The MAX817LCSA monitors system voltage and provides a reset signal to the microprocessor if the supply voltage drops below a preset threshold.  
- It ensures proper system operation by holding the microprocessor in reset during power-up, power-down, or brownout conditions.  
- The reset output remains asserted for a fixed delay after the supply voltage rises above the threshold.
